- ベストアンサー
WEBサーバーでActiveDirecotryの認証を使う方法
WEBサーバーでActiveDirecotryの認証を使う方法 現在、LAN内のWindowsサーバーにWEBページをを置いて ADサーバーにログインした特定のユーザーにだけWEBページを公開がしたいと考えています。 ApacheのIPアドレスによるアクセス制限のようにログインユーザーによるアクセス制限がしたいです。 可能でしょうか?理想は、基本認証のようなログインダイアログは出したくないです。 また、IISを使えば可能といった情報でも構いません。 ご存知の方がいましたら教えてください。宜しくお願いします。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
IISであれば問題なく実現出来ます。 単純な方法としては、IISのバージョンが不明なので大まかな手順になりますが、 ・サイト又はディレクトリの認証の設定を「Windows認証」のみにする。(デフォルトでは匿名も有効になっているのでこれを無効にする) ・公開するコンテンツが格納されているディレクトリ以下のNTFSアクセス権を特定ユーザーのみ読み取りが出来るように設定する。 以上で出来ると思います。 認証はシームレスに行われますのでダイアログは出ずに認証がOKならばアクセスが可能になります。 余談ですがIPアドレスによる制限ももちろん出来ます。
お礼
IISを使えばそのようなアクセス制限ができるとは知りませんでした。 早速試してみます。ご回答有難うございました。